About Gabriel Conroy
Gabriel Conroy was born in Los Angeles, California, in 1967. After high school, he joined the armed forces and was stationed in Germany for several years. He discovered his love for writing while traveling through Europe. When he returned, he studied journalism at Los Angeles City College and UCLA. He currently works as a freelance journalist, writer, and translator.
About Andrew Wincott
Andrew Wincott is an experienced stage actor and voice artist. A graduate of Christ Church, Oxford, he trained at the Webber Douglas Academy. He has performed Shakespeare, Shaw, Shaffer, Moliere, and more, has twice been a member of the BBC Radio Drama Company, has created voices for countless computer games, and has recorded over a hundred audiobooks.
About Anthony Skordi
Anthony Skordi was born in London and attended Drama Centre London. He was a member of the Royal Shakespeare Company and Vanessa Redgrave’s Moving Theatre company. Skordi wrote and performed in Onassis, the Play. He has voiced many video games, promos, and trailers and continues working both in the United States and Europe.
About Emma Tate
Emma Tate is a British voice actress known for many roles, including the voice of the title character in Harry and His Bucket Full of Dinosaurs and Mowgli in the television series The Jungle Book. Tate’s acting debut came in a 1991 episode of The Bill and in 1999 her voice acting career began, starting with the US version of Bob the Builder. In 2006, Tate began to voice Perfect Peter in the television adaptation of Francesca Simon’s book Horrid Henry.
